Benefits of Hiring a Digital Marketing Agency in Charleston vs. Building an In-House Team

January 6, 2025

Benefits of Hiring a Digital Marketing Agency in Charleston vs. Building an In-House Team

In today’s competitive landscape, small and large businesses prioritize digital marketing to drive growth, generate leads, and build brand awareness. For businesses in Charleston, SC, the question often arises – should you hire a digital marketing agency or build an in-house team? While both approaches have their merits, partnering with a professional digital marketing company can provide significant advantages that save time, money, and resources.

Here’s why hiring a digital marketing agency in Charleston might be the best decision for your business.

 

1. Access to a Team of Experts

Building an in-house digital marketing team requires hiring specialists in multiple areas – SEO, PPC, content creation, social media, and data analysis. This can become expensive and time-consuming. Working with a Charleston digital marketing agency gives you access to a full team of experienced professionals with diverse skill sets. From crafting compelling ad campaigns to optimizing your website for search engines, an agency offers comprehensive expertise that is hard to replicate internally.

 

2. Cost-Effective Solution

Hiring and maintaining an in-house marketing team comes with overhead costs, including salaries, benefits, training, and software. In contrast, a digital marketing company in Charleston operates on a flexible contract basis, allowing you to scale services based on your needs and budget. Agencies have the tools and resources to execute campaigns efficiently, maximizing your return on investment (ROI) without the burden of hiring full-time staff.

 

3. Focus on Core Business Activities

Marketing is crucial, but it shouldn’t take focus away from your core business operations. By outsourcing your marketing needs to a digital marketing agency, your internal team can concentrate on product development, customer service, and daily operations. This ensures that every part of your business runs smoothly while the agency handles campaign management, lead generation, and brand growth.

 

4. Cutting-Edge Tools and Technology

Digital marketing relies heavily on tools and analytics software to track performance, conduct keyword research, and manage campaigns. Investing in these tools can be costly for businesses, especially smaller ones. A digital marketing agency already has access to premium marketing tools and platforms, ensuring your campaigns are data-driven and optimized for success.

 

5. Faster Results and Proven Strategies

An experienced digital marketing company in Charleston understands local market trends, audience behavior, and competitive landscapes. Agencies can launch campaigns quickly, leveraging proven strategies that deliver results. On the other hand, in-house teams may require time to develop and test strategies, slowing down your overall marketing efforts.

 

6. Scalability and Flexibility

Business needs change over time, and a digital marketing agency offers the flexibility to scale efforts up or down depending on your goals. Whether you need to ramp up PPC advertising during a product launch or focus on SEO for long-term growth, agencies can adapt their services to meet your evolving needs.

 

7. Fresh Perspective and Creativity

One of the biggest advantages of hiring a digital marketing agency is gaining an outside perspective. Agencies work with a variety of industries, bringing innovative ideas and creative strategies to the table. This outside input can inject new life into your campaigns and prevent stagnation.

 

Contact Our Digital Marketing Agency Today

For businesses in Charleston, SC, partnering with a digital marketing agency like RDM offers significant advantages over building an in-house team. From cost savings to specialized expertise and cutting-edge tools, agencies provide the resources and flexibility needed to drive growth and success.

Read Other Recent Posts

blog writing services

How to Use Blog Posts to Improve SEO

Blog posts can transform a business’s online presence, helping brands move from invisibility to influence. Blogging is more than writing—it’s a way to connect, educate, and build trust while giving your website the visibility it deserves. Blogs can enhance your SEO, help your audience find you, and why consistent, authentic storytelling matters more than ever.

Nov 1, 2025
technology location navigation business and mod 2025 10 11 12 22 30 utc

What to Put on a Location Page (Above the Fold to Footer)

A location page is more than just an address on a map. It’s a digital handshake, the first impression your business makes to potential customers searching for your services in a specific area. A well-structured location page does more than provide information; it...

Oct 10, 2025
How Can an SEO Agency Help to Build Your Business?

How Can an SEO Agency Help to Build Your Business?

Search engine optimization (SEO) has become one of the most powerful tools for growing a business in the digital era. Yet, many business owners still view SEO as a mystery—something that only big companies with large budgets can use effectively. The reality is that...

Sep 19, 2025
Maximizing ROI with Smart Bidding Strategies in Google Ads

Maximizing ROI with Smart Bidding Strategies in Google Ads

When it comes to Google Ads, every dollar counts. Whether you’re a local boutique in Mount Pleasant or a growing e-commerce brand, your goal is the same: get the most return for every dollar you spend. That’s what makes smart bidding strategies a game-changer in...

Aug 7, 2025
The Anatomy of a Perfectly Optimized Page in 2025

How to Conduct a Comprehensive Technical SEO Audit

When it comes to ranking on Google, great content is only half the battle. The other half? Technical SEO. You could have the most compelling blog post or service page in the world, but if your site has slow loading speeds, crawl errors, or broken links, Google...

Jul 8, 2025